Letter: Students should be on Economic Development Board

By Vonnie Kolbenschlag

I think the extraordinary talent shown by the three LWU students' merits their inclusion on the Adair County Economic Development Board. Winning a National Marketing Competition is quite an accomplishment, in my opinion. Including them on the ACEB is an opportunity for using their recognized talents and skills. Also, 'real problem solving' at the local level by students may be even more meaningful than winning a contest.
